Abstract | ||||
Toxicity of certain insecticides Emamectin benzoate (E) IGRs, Diflorate (D) 25%, Grand (G) 5% EC, mineral oil KZ oil (KZ) and plant oil Garlic oil (GO) were tested against strain producer laboratory of 4th larvae instar of Spodoptera littoralis (Boisd) The LC50, LC25 and LC10 were calculated for all treatments. The mixtures results may be arrangement in categories as following; 1. Mixtures showed that highest potential action by the lowest concentration of LC25+ LC10 (E+D), LC25+ LC10 (E+ G), LC10+ LC25 (E+ G), LC25+ LC10 (E+ Kz), LC10+ LC25 (D+ G), LC10+ LC25 (D+ Kz), LC10+ LC10 (G+ G) and LC10+ LC25 (G+ Kz); 2. Mixtures revealed that antagonism action LC10+ LC50 (E+ D), LC10+ LC25 (E+ G), LC10+ LC50 (E+ Kz), LC25+ LC50 (G+ G) and LC25+ LC50 (G+ Kz); 3. Mixtures cleared that additive effective LC25+ LC50 (E+ D), LC50+ LC10 (E+ G), LC25+ LC25 (E+ G), LC50+ LC50 (E+ Kz), LC50+ LC25 (D+ G), LC25+ LC25 (G+ G) and LC50+ LC25 (G+ Kz) though, use IGRs, plant or mineral oils, compounds in binamy as a mixture with little concentrations, it has been shown to be effective in controlling of S. littoralis. | ||||
